If the pharmacy is still shipping it but your doc has notified your insurance carrier that he is no longer prescribing it, you might have an issue with getting it paid for. 2. All Xolair cartons have an expiration date on them. Xolair vials are good if kept cold until the expiration date. 3. Do you have a history of early onset arthritis in your family. Mine was masked by the steroids I was taking until I started Xolair and came off prednisone. Good luck, and keep us posted on how you are doing.
